Re: Spiral Wrapped Jerk Bait rods
In my opinion...
I've seen guys say that they don't want a spiral wrap because they work their bait in a tip down fashion. Not just jerks, but cranks, and other lures.
Working the bait is one of the last reasons to, or not to, spiral wrap a rod. The amount of force applied by a lure pales in comparison to fighting a fish. This is where the spiral comes into play because your guides are now on the correct side of the rod blank, the underside. As you raise your rod tip to fight the fish, the load from that fish wants to turn those guides to the underside. You can even see a low modulus blank twist because of this force. Why not just put the guides where they want to be in the first place?
